Sea Turtle Hospital News We’re always ready to talk turtle. And during 2022 we had plenty to talk about. Last year we admitted the highest number of turtles in our history – 119. That number doesn’t include the patients we had on-site at the beginning of the year – 140 patients in total. To say we were exceptionally busy would be an understatement. News from the Sea Turtle Hospital We haven’t seen a lot of activity with local cold-stuns, but any critter that hasn’t made tracks out of Dodge by now is living on the edge. The water and air temps have dropped way below sea turtle comfy.
